Authorship and Creation
Cargo's producer is recorded as Andrea Calderwood[15]. Cargo's director is recorded as Clive Gordon[5]. Cargo's screenwriter is recorded as Paul Laverty[6]. Cast members include Peter Mullan[9], Daniel Brühl[10], Luis Tosar[11], Samuli Edelmann[12], Gary Lewis[13], and Nikki Amuka-Bird[14].
Publication
Cargo's publication date is recorded as +2006-01-01T00:00:00Z[21]. Original languages include English[17] and Spanish[18]. Cargo's genre is recorded as thriller film[8].
